Abstract
The data center network should provide a sufficiently large bandwidth between servers with limited energy consumption. One approach to achieving this is through optical data center networks that use optical switches. There are two kinds of optical switches: optical packet and optical circuit switches. This chapter provides an overview of the architectures for these optical switches. Then, we introduce two approaches using optical switches.
